    UAE President Engages with German Business Leaders During State Visit to Enhance Economic Collaboration

    BERLIN / RankWire.AI / – In Berlin this week, President His Highness Sheikh Mohamed bin Zayed Al Nahyan held discussions with prominent German corporate executives and business figures as part of his official visit to the Federal Republic of Germany. The high-level roundtable saw the UAE President receive detailed briefings on company operations, industrial sectors, and technological advancements spanning key European manufacturing regions. As both countries seek to deepen economic ties, Sheikh Mohamed emphasized efforts to expand cross-border commercial collaborations, joint ventures, and trade across strategic growth markets.

    The talks concentrated on boosting trade and investment links between the United Arab Emirates and Germany, emphasizing the private sector’s role in spearheading innovation in industry, artificial intelligence, and clean energy projects. Sheikh Mohamed reiterated the UAE’s dedication to maintaining an attractive investment climate, bolstered by legislative support, modern regulatory systems, and access to international logistics hubs. UAE President meets German business leaders as bilateral non-oil trade volume reached €13.4 billion, highlighting the growing economic integration linking European manufacturing hubs with Middle Eastern trade networks.

    This encounter coincided with the bilateral business forum held in Munich, where government officials and corporate leaders signed 30 memoranda of understanding and commercial agreements valued at €9.66 billion. Official statements released via the Emirates News Agency confirmed these accords target sectors with high growth potential, including advanced manufacturing, renewable energy, robotics, healthcare technology, and port infrastructure. UAE Minister for Foreign Trade Dr. Thani bin Ahmed Al Zeyoudi pointed out that UAE investments in Germany have risen to €34.5 billion, reflecting robust institutional investment flows between the two economies.

    German business leaders expressed keen interest in expanding their activities within the UAE, citing the country’s strategic position as a key trade route connecting European exporters to markets in the Middle East, Asia, and Africa. Participants discussed strategic initiatives aimed at accelerating joint R&D efforts in green hydrogen production, industrial automation, and digital infrastructure resilience.

    The visit also included bilateral economic talks led by Federal Minister of Economic Affairs Katherina Reiche and German Chancellor Friedrich Merz. Both sides announced the launch of a new Strategic Dialogue format, revitalizing the bilateral Comprehensive Strategic Partnership established in 2004. This framework aims to guide joint advancements in areas such as international security, clean energy, transportation, and defense technology sectors.
